Why Small Businesses Need Dedicated Accounting Software
Manual spreadsheets or basic tools often lead to inaccuracies, missed deadlines, and missed growth opportunities. Modern cloud-based solutions offer automation, bank feeds, real-time collaboration, and tax compliance features that scale with your business.
Key benefits include:
- Time savings: Automated reconciliation and invoicing cut manual work dramatically.
- Better decision-making: Instant dashboards show profitability, cash flow, and trends.
- Compliance and security: Built-in support for VAT, GST, payroll taxes, and secure data backups.
- Scalability: Start simple and add advanced inventory, multi-currency, or payroll as you grow.
With options ranging from free tools to robust platforms, there’s a solution for nearly every budget and need.
Top Features to Look for in Small Business Accounting Software
When evaluating the best small business accounting software, prioritize these:
- Ease of use: Intuitive interface with mobile apps.
- Bank reconciliation: Automatic matching of transactions.
- Invoicing and payments: Professional templates, recurring bills, and online payments.
- Expense tracking: Receipt scanning and categorization.
- Reporting and analytics: Profit/loss, balance sheets, and tax-ready reports.
- Integrations: With payment processors, e-commerce, CRM, and payroll tools.
- Mobile access and support: Reliable customer service and app functionality.
- Pricing transparency: Scalable plans without hidden fees.

QuickBooks Online: The All-Rounder Favorite
QuickBooks Online frequently earns the title of best overall for its comprehensive features and vast ecosystem. It’s ideal for businesses selling products and services, with strong inventory, payroll, and multi-entity support.
Strengths:
- Advanced reporting and AI-powered categorization.
- Excellent for US and international users, including robust payroll.
- Deep integrations and accountant-friendly design.
Considerations: Higher pricing tiers can add up for very small teams.
Xero: User-Friendly and Collaborative
Xero shines for its clean interface, unlimited users on most plans, and strong automation. It’s a top pick for growing teams and international operations.
Strengths:
- Beautiful dashboards and excellent bank feeds.
- Strong multi-currency and inventory tools.
- Popular among accountants for collaboration.
Considerations: Some advanced features rely on add-ons.
FreshBooks: Ideal for Service-Based Businesses
FreshBooks excels in time tracking, project management, and beautiful invoicing perfect for freelancers, consultants, and agencies.
Strengths:
- Exceptional user experience and client portal.
- Automated expense and time billing.
- Strong for service-focused workflows.
Wave: Best Free Option for Microbusinesses
Wave offers core accounting, invoicing, and receipts for free, making it accessible for startups and solopreneurs.
Strengths:
- No cost for basics.
- Solid mobile app and payment processing (with fees).
Considerations: Limited advanced reporting and scalability.
Other notable mentions include Zoho Books (affordable with CRM integration), Sage (desktop/cloud hybrid), and MYOB (popular in Australia).
Comparison Table: Best Small Business Accounting Software
| Software | Best For | Starting Price (approx., monthly) | Key Features | Ratings (2026) | Drawbacks |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| QuickBooks Online | Most businesses, products/services | $38+ | Payroll, inventory, advanced reports | 4.5-5.0 | Can feel feature-heavy |
| Xero | Growing teams, international | $25+ | Unlimited users, multi-currency | 4.5+ | Add-ons for some features |
| FreshBooks | Freelancers, service-based | $23+ | Time tracking, client portal | 4.7+ | Less robust for inventory |
| Wave | Microbusinesses, beginners | Free (payments extra) | Basic bookkeeping, invoicing | 4.5 | Limited scalability |
| Zoho Books | Value & CRM integration | Low teens | Automation, strong reporting | 4.4+ | Learning curve for some |
This table highlights how different tools suit varied needs. Prices fluctuate; always check official sites.
Best Small Business Accounting Software UK
UK businesses require MTD (Making Tax Digital) compliance, VAT handling, and seamless HMRC integration. QuickBooks and Xero lead here, with strong VAT tools and payroll.
QuickBooks is often ranked top for UK SMEs due to organized bookkeeping and real-time tracking. Xero offers excellent support and automation tailored to UK regulations. Both reduce compliance headaches significantly.
Best Small Business Accounting Software Australia
Australian users need GST/BAS support, Single Touch Payroll (STP), and local integrations. Xero and MYOB dominate, with QuickBooks also strong.
Xero is highly regarded for its cloud-first approach and Australian compliance features. QuickBooks provides solid GST tracking and BAS lodgment. Reckon and Sage are additional local favorites for specific workflows.

How to Choose the Right Software for Your Business
- Assess your needs: Inventory? Payroll? International sales?
- Consider team size and growth: Unlimited users or per-user pricing?
- Budget: Free starters vs. premium features.
- Trial it: Most offer 14-30 day trials.
- Accountant input: Choose software your accountant prefers for easier handoffs.
- Integrations: Ensure compatibility with your other tools (e.g., Shopify, Stripe).
Test 2-3 options with your real data for the best fit.

Implementation Tips and Common Pitfalls
Start with bank feeds and basic categorization. Train your team (or yourself) on key features. Regularly review reports rather than just inputting data. Avoid over-customization early on keep it simple and scale features as needed.
Common pitfalls include ignoring mobile access, skipping data migration planning, or choosing based solely on price without considering long-term value.
